#09046f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#09046f is composed of 3.5% red, 1.6%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.9% cyan, 96.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 242.8 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 22.5%. #09046f color hex could be obtained by blending #1208de with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

● #09046f color description : Very dark blue.
#09046f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#09046f has RGB values of R:9, G:4,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 590959.

Shades and Tints of #09046f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010110 is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.
